20 Shot uses an iPhone camera to capture comic strips, contact sheets, flip-books, and other grids of sequential images, then converts selected panels into looping videos. It includes grid and single-frame capture, crop adjustment, edge cleanup, playback ordering, visual enhancements, recording controls, and export to Photos.
